Linkers are used to tell or explain more about the first idea in the sentence.

Eg: furthermore, besides that, moreover etc. Pupils are not encourage to use these words in writing at this stage because it may distort the meaning of the sentence. Most of the pupils fail to use the words clearly and marks will be deducted for this.

A complex sentence contains one main idea and one supporting idea.

Main idea

Amin, who is a handsome boy is my friend.

supporting idea

Question 3 To assess candidates ability to express ideas in sentences with correct structures.

TASK: To write sentences about the pictures in a paragraph or paragraphs using the given words and express their ideas cretively.

Confident use of the language Ideas conveyed clearly through a variety of sentence structures. Confident use of new words to express ideas. Ideas are well-planned, relevant and are linked so as to sustain the interest of the reader. Overall accurate use of spelling and punctuation. 13 - 15 marks

Look at the pictures. Try to answer these questions: Who are the people? What are they doing? What is happening in each picture? Where is the place?

Look at the words given. Use the words to make complete sentences. You have to add words to make each sentence complete
Begin each sentence with a capital letter. Add a full stop at the end of every sentence. Arrange the sentences in paragraphs. Make sure you use all the words. Check the spelling and grammar correctly.

Tenses Spelling Punctuation to + infinitive Flow of ideas and proper sequencing.

Suitable vocabulary adjectives


/linking words/ conjunctions.

adverbs

Interesting expressions and use of similies and proverbs where possible. Writing must be neat and legible.

Expand the sentences by adding suitable new words and phrases. Make sure the information added appropriate to the story line. The quality of the sentence carries more marks and not the number or length of sentences written. Check your answers for grammatical or spelling errors.

At least 3 paragraphs 5 paragraphs with an introduction and a closure would help 1st paragraph introduction 2nd paragraph describes picture A 3rd paragraph describes picture B 4th paragraph describes picture C 5th paragraph closure
